The function `f(x)=(sin(pi[x-pi]))/(4+[x]^2)` , where `[]` denotes the greatest integer function, is continuous as well as differentiable for all `x in R`
(b) continuous for all `x` but not differentiable at some `x`
(c) differentiable for all `x` but not continuous at some `x`
. (d) none of these

Text Solution

Verified by Experts

As,` [x]^2+4!=0`
Also `[x−pi]` is always an integer
So,`p[x−pi]` is of the form `kpi` (k is any integer)
and hence f(x) is identically the zero function for all x.
So it is a constant function.
Thus it is differentiable for all x
